Description:
The Annual Population Survey is a dataset that is made up of Labour Force Survey responses in the first and fifth waves of interviewing, plus a boost sample where respondents are interviewed annually for up to four consecutive years. The datasets consist of around 250,000 individuals, each of whom only appear once in the dataset (the use of the first and fifth waves avoids response being counted twice). The larger sample makes the data better suited for estimates of employment (etc.) at local authority level. Comprehensive information regarding the surveys is available via the user guidance and also the QMI pages for both the LFS and AP.

Access
Access Service:
The SAIL Databank is powered by the UK Secure e-Research Platform (UKSeRP).
Following approval through safeguard processes, access to project-specific data
within the secure environment is permitted using two-factor authentication.
Access Request Cost:
Data provision is free from SAIL. Overall project costing depends on the number
of people that require access to the SAIL Gateway, the activities that SAIL
needs to complete (e.g. loading non-standard datasets), data refreshes,
analytical work required, disclosure control process, and special case
technological requirements.
